Total failure

My parents had a rear bearing completely fail on a Renault many years ago as they were going to Cork to a funeral. The rear wheel passed them out on the road, it fell off the hub!

Nobody hurt, they got it fixed, and went on their way.

I myself had a rear wheel bearing go on my Honda VFR 750 motorcycle in the south of England on the motorway. Pretty scary. The bike shook it's head like a bronc at a rodeo. I had to move over three lanes without dropping the machine, or I would be dead under a lot of fast traffic.

Got it fixed, and we continued the tour.

Moral of the stories:
If I hear a wheel bearing noise, I get it fixed.
